Job Description

The Model Risk Management Group (MRMG) is responsible for oversight of model risk and governance over machine learning usage enterprise wide. The role will be primarily responsible for the review of credit risk, fraud risk, and line management models. The responsibilities of the individual are also to ensure that there is an elevation of modeling as well as fulfilling regulatory requirements for model risk management. This is a highly competitive role and one that ensures the individual achieves maximum potential intellectually as well as for the company.

Responsibilities

This role will report to a director in MRMG. The specific responsibilities include:
  • Oversee credit risk, fraud risk, and line management models which include evaluating conceptual soundness, data quality, performance validation, and on-going monitoring
  • Document detailed model review reports and prepare for regulatory and internal audit reviews
  • Communicate model review results to business partners, senior leaders, and regulators
  • Evaluate machine learning algorithms and their application on models
  • Enhance governance framework to accommodate the evolving modeling techniques, model development, as well as model risk management

Qualifications

  • Advanced degree in quantitative fields
  • Hands-on modeling experience is preferred
  • The qualified candidate should have a good understanding of machine learning algorithms (e.g., gradient boosting machine, XGBoost, neural network), artificial intelligence, deep learning as well as classic statistical modeling techniques and assumptions.
  • Experience in large data processing and handling is a plus-familiarity with big data platforms and applications, such as Hadoop, Pig, Hive, Spark, AWS.
  • Must be skilled in coding using Python/R; additionally, Java, Scala, and C++ a plus.
  • Strong communication and written skills
  • Flexibility and adaptability to work within tight deadlines and changing priorities
